GLACIERS EDGE COUNCIL DISTINGUISHED EAGLE SCOUTS


The Distinguished Eagle Scout Award was established in 1969 to acknowledge Eagle Scouts who have
received extraordinary national-level recognition, fame, or eminence within their field, and have a
strong record of voluntary service to their community. Only Eagle Scouts who earned the Eagle Scout
rank a minimum of 25 years previously are eligible for nomination. The award is given by the
National Eagle Scout Association upon the recommendation of a committee of Distinguished Eagle
Scouts.
To date two individuals have earned the Distinguished Eagle Scout Award:
Dr. Lewis Harned and Governor Scott Walker.

JOURNEY TO EXCELLENCE 2014


Scouting's Journey to Excellence" is the Boy Scout of Americas performance recognition program designed
to encourage and reward success and measure the performance of our units, districts, and councils. It is
meant to encourage excellence in providing a quality program at all levels of the BSA.

FOR DISTINGUISHED SERVICE TO YOUTH

2015 SILVER BEAVER AWARD


RECIPIENTS
The strength of the Scouting movement lies in the dedicated support of its volunteers; the men and women who work tirelessly on
behalf of the youth of our communities. The Silver Beaver award is the highest award the GLACIERS EDGE COUNCIL, Boy
Scouts of America, can bestow - yet it is a small tribute compared to the thanks earned from the youths themselves. The number
of people a council can honor with the Silver Beaver award each year is determined by the number of chartered units at year-end,
one for every 60 units in the council. In the past 84 years, almost 500 individuals have been presented with this award.

THE SILVER ANTELOPE AND SILVER BUFFALO AWARD


The Silver Buffalo and the Silver Antelope are awards that are given by the National and Regional Councils, respectively, to
recognize the efforts of volunteers on behalf of the Boy Scouts of America outside of the local council. The Silver Buffalo Award
that was developed and presented for the first time in 1926. Here are the individuals that have presented these awards within the
area that is now Glaciers Edge Council, Boy Scouts of America.

2014 DISTRICT AWARD OF MERIT


The District Award of Merit is the highest award a District can bestow on an individual Scouter for their
service to youth in the district. In accordance with National, a District can present no more than one Award
for every 25 units in the District. The following volunteers were presented a District Award of Merit in 2014.

DID YOU KNOW?


The 135 Glaciers Edge Council Scouts
who achieved the rank of Eagle in 2015:
Directed Eagle Projects that involved
17,871 hours of service to complete
Were from 68 different Troops
Earned more than 3,262 merit badges
Each Scout had to complete 13 required
merit badges which included First Aid,
Communication, Cooking, and
Personal Management
Helped provide Youth Leadership to
their units
Successfully completed an Eagle Board
of Review run by volunteers outside
their Troop
Prepared a statement of their ambitions
and life purpose
